We will be the only ship in port (900 pax) in the next couple weeks for a full day (0700-1800). We plan on leaving the ship first thing before excursions and catching a cab to Nelson’s Dockyard. Having never been, we don’t want to be rushed, yet don’t know how much time to estimate spending there. Is this a good place to have lunch and hang?  Following Nelson’s we would like to spend some beach time not too far from the ship. Maybe wait until then for lunch?  We have considered Limerz after all the great reviews and correspondence with Gail, but not sure if that makes sense for what could be a few hours. 

I would appreciate some guidance on how much time to allow at Nelson’s as well as short beach day options that may or may not Include lunch, but should include drinks/loungers/snacks.

On the way back to the ship is Jacqui O's.  This is a great place for Luch, Drinks, Beach and hang out.  Let Lance know you are arriving for Lunch to reserve your space.

All I have left to recommend is Sheer Rocks.  It is Michelen standard Restaurant that serves a delicious light lunch menu, with a bar, loungers, sadly no beach, but it is a very nice place to chill.  Again book in advance, as loungers are at a premium.

 

Recommend their Mai Tai, as it just suits the ambience and view.
